What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Giddings, TX?

In Giddings, outdoor uncovered storage is the most affordable option, typically ranging from $40 to $80 per month for standard-sized boats, depending on the facility's amenities and location. Covered storage (like carports or canopies) usually costs between $80 and $150 monthly, offering protection from sun and rain. Fully enclosed, climate-controlled indoor storage is less common in the immediate area but may be available in nearby cities like Bastrop or Austin for $150 to $300+ per month. Prices in Giddings are generally lower than in major metro areas, but availability can be tight during the off-season. It's advisable to book early, especially for covered spots, to secure the best rates.

How does the Central Texas climate in Giddings affect long-term boat storage needs?

Giddings experiences hot, humid summers and mild winters with occasional freezes. For long-term storage, sun exposure is a primary concern; UV rays can degrade upholstery, gel coats, and tires, making covered or indoor storage highly recommended. While snowfall is rare, winter temperatures can dip below freezing, so proper winterization—including draining the engine, adding antifreeze, and protecting plumbing systems—is essential to prevent freeze damage. High humidity can also promote mold and mildew, so using moisture absorbers and ensuring good ventilation in storage units is important. Many local storage facilities are familiar with these regional climate challenges and can offer advice or services.

Are there specific regulations or permits required for storing a boat in Giddings, TX?

Giddings itself does not have unique city permits specifically for boat storage on private property or at commercial facilities, but you must comply with Texas state and local ordinances. If storing on your own property, ensure it's allowed by your neighborhood's HOA covenants and is not in violation of any city codes regarding vehicle/boat parking. For commercial storage, facilities must have proper zoning. All boats must have current Texas registration and, if applicable, a valid trailer license plate. It's also wise to check with your storage provider about their insurance requirements; most facilities require proof of your own boat insurance while they provide liability coverage for the premises.

What security features should I look for in a boat storage facility in the Giddings area?

Given Giddings' rural setting, security is a key consideration. Look for facilities with 24/7 video surveillance, gated access with personalized entry codes, and well-lit premises. Many reputable storage providers in the area also have on-site management or regular patrols. For added protection, especially for high-value boats, inquire about individually alarmed units or fenced perimeters. Some facilities may offer additional features like motion-activated lights or security signage. It's always a good practice to visit the facility in person to assess its security measures and overall condition before committing to a storage agreement.
